asp 服务器 配置文件_ASP报告信息
创始人
2024-10-14 07:37:49
0

ASP服务器配置文件概览

asp 服务器 配置文件_ASP报告信息(图片来源网络,侵删)

在ASP(Active Server Pages)技术中,服务器配置文件扮演着至关重要的角色,它定义了Web服务器的行为和处理请求的方式,这些配置文件通常包含设置、指令和配置参数,确保ASP应用程序按照预期运行。

配置文件的位置和名称

配置文件的位置取决于所使用的Web服务器软件,在微软的IIS(Internet Information Services)服务器上,主要配置文件通常名为web.config,并且位于ASP应用程序的根目录或特定子目录中。

配置文件的主要作用

配置应用程序设置:如错误页面、会话状态管理等。

安全性设置:定义认证模式、授权规则等。

状态管理:配置会话、应用程序状态等。

调试和错误处理:设置调试模式、自定义错误页等。

配置文件的结构

配置文件通常由XML标记构成,每个标记代表一个配置节,下面是一个简化版的web.config文件结构示例:

                                                                     

详细配置说明

系统级配置

1、编译设置:指定默认的页面语言和编译选项。

2、认证设置:定义用户认证的方式,如Windows、表单、Passport等。

3、自定义错误:配置错误页显示方式和远程访问权限。

4、会话状态:设置会话数据的存储模式和管理超时等。

应用程序设置

通过元素,可以在Web.config文件中添加自定义应用程序设置,这些设置可以通过代码中的ConfigurationManager类进行访问。

安全性配置

安全配置是Web.config文件中的重要组成部分,包括:

认证模式:配置如何验证用户身份。

授权规则:定义哪些用户可以访问应用程序的哪些部分。

服务和资源的权限:控制对特定资源和服务的访问。

状态管理配置

状态管理配置允许开发者管理会话状态、应用程序状态等,这对于维持用户的登录状态和跨页面共享数据非常重要。

常见状态管理配置

会话状态模式:如InProc(内存中)、StateServer(单独的状态服务器)、SQLServer(数据库存储)。

Cookie设置:配置Cookie的使用,如是否启用Cookieless会话。

超时设置:定义会话何时过期。

调试和错误处理配置

为了帮助开发者诊断和解决问题,ASP提供了强大的调试和错误处理配置选项。

调试模式:开启或关闭调试信息输出。

自定义错误页:为不同类型的错误定义自定义的错误响应页面。

跟踪:启用请求跟踪以记录详细的请求处理信息。

实践中的应用示例

在实际开发中,开发者需要根据应用程序的具体需求来调整配置文件的设置,如果应用程序需要使用数据库会话状态,那么需要在节中将mode设置为SQLServer,并提供相应的数据库连接字符串。

相关问答FAQs

Q1: 如果我希望限制对某个文件夹的访问,我应该如何配置?

A1: 你可以在该文件夹下创建一个Web.config文件,并使用节来配置访问规则,如果你想限制匿名用户访问,可以这样配置:

                          

Q2: 我如何更改我的应用程序的默认错误页?

A2: 你可以在Web.config文件中的节内配置默认错误页,如果你想将所有错误重定向到名为ErrorPage.aspx的页面,可以这样设置:

              

相关内容

热门资讯

秒懂教程“微信金花链接在哪买,... 大厅金花是一款非常受欢迎的棋牌游戏,咨询房/卡添加微信:15984933许多玩家在游戏中会购买房卡来...
房卡必备教程“去哪儿买微信金花... 金花是一款非常受欢迎的棋牌游戏,咨询房/卡添加微信:160470940许多玩家在游戏中会购买房卡来享...
正版授权“微信金花链接房卡平台... 金花是一款非常受欢迎的棋牌游戏,咨询房/卡添加微信:15984933许多玩家在游戏中会购买房卡来享受...
秒懂教程“牛牛房卡购买渠道,新... 新神盾是一款非常受欢迎的棋牌游戏,咨询房/卡添加微信:160470940许多玩家在游戏中会购买房卡来...
一分钟推荐“斗牛房卡怎么购买”... 斗牛是一款非常受欢迎的棋牌游戏,咨询房/卡添加微信:160470940许多玩家在游戏中会购买房卡来享...
终于找到“如何购买金花房卡普及... 新漫游牛牛是一款非常受欢迎的棋牌游戏,咨询房/卡添加微信:44346008许多玩家在游戏中会购买房卡...
终于找到“炸金花链接如何开房卡... 金花是一款非常受欢迎的棋牌游戏,咨询房/卡添加微信:44346008许多玩家在游戏中会购买房卡来享受...
终于找到“金花链接房卡到哪里买... 微信网页牛牛是一款非常受欢迎的棋牌游戏,咨询房/卡添加微信:160470940许多玩家在游戏中会购买...
ia实测“怎么购买微信炸金花房... 微信炸金花是一款非常受欢迎的棋牌游戏,咨询房/卡添加微信:44346008许多玩家在游戏中会购买房卡...
ia实测“微信链接牛牛房卡怎么... 新八戒是一款非常受欢迎的棋牌游戏,咨询房/卡添加微信:15984933许多玩家在游戏中会购买房卡来享...
ia实测“微信炸金花链接在哪里... 微信炸金花是一款非常受欢迎的棋牌游戏,咨询房/卡添加微信:15984933许多玩家在游戏中会购买房卡...
秒懂教程“微信群发的链接金花怎... 金花是一款非常受欢迎的棋牌游戏,咨询房/卡添加微信:160470940许多玩家在游戏中会购买房卡来享...
给大家讲解“金花链接的房卡在哪... 新九九牛牛是一款非常受欢迎的棋牌游戏,咨询房/卡添加微信:86909166许多玩家在游戏中会购买房卡...
给大家讲解“微信牛牛链接金花房... 新蓝鲸是一款非常受欢迎的棋牌游戏,咨询房/卡添加微信:160470940许多玩家在游戏中会购买房卡来...
秒懂教程“斗牛房卡在哪购买,新... 新世界牛牛是一款非常受欢迎的棋牌游戏,咨询房/卡添加微信:86909166许多玩家在游戏中会购买房卡...
秒懂教程“微信金花房卡链接使用... 新乐乐金花是一款非常受欢迎的棋牌游戏,咨询房/卡添加微信:15984933许多玩家在游戏中会购买房卡...
房卡必备教程“微信牛牛房卡招代... 炫酷大厅是一款非常受欢迎的棋牌游戏,咨询房/卡添加微信:86909166许多玩家在游戏中会购买房卡来...
正版授权“牛牛房卡的客服联系方... 牛牛是一款非常受欢迎的棋牌游戏,咨询房/卡添加微信:44346008许多玩家在游戏中会购买房卡来享受...
一分钟了解“牛牛金花房卡是如何... 牛牛是一款非常受欢迎的棋牌游戏,咨询房/卡添加微信:86909166许多玩家在游戏中会购买房卡来享受...
秒懂教程“开牛牛群怎么买房卡”... 牛牛是一款非常受欢迎的棋牌游戏,咨询房/卡添加微信:86909166许多玩家在游戏中会购买房卡来享受...